The Greninger Lab has an outstanding opportunity for a 1.0 FTE Postdoctoral Scholar in the area of syphilis immunology and genomics for a newly funded project. The Greninger Lab has made major contributions to the genomics of Treponema pallidum, developing new wet-lab and dry-lab pipelines for whole genome sequencing, genome finishing, and deep profiling of the immunoevasive TprK gene, as well as phage display profiling of the serological response to this mercurial pathogen. The goal of the present work is to contribute greater functional interpretation of the sequences available for Treponema pallidum as well as proteome-wide profiling of the rabbit and human immune response to Treponema pallidum, with the goal of contributing to the development of an effective vaccine. The Greninger Lab works closely with the laboratory of Dr. Lorenzo Giacani in support of these goals. The work requires a highly invested PhD-level individual with prior experience in molecular biology, biochemistry, microbiology/virology/immunology, and informatics skills. Responsibilities include constructing and teaching others on the generation of next-generation sequencing libraries, performing and overseeing immunoprecipitations, analyzing sequencing data, visualizing data and programming figures, drafting of manuscripts and grants for submission, combined with follow-on wet-lab experiments to confirm hypotheses generated in the above screens.
